Многие пользователи операционной системы Windows 10 и Windows 11 при попытке освободить место на диске или просто из любопытства обнаруживают скрытую папку с названием WindowsApps. Обычно она занимает значительный объем дискового пространства и вызывает множество вопросов у владельцев компьютеров. Что хранится внутри этой директории, почему она скрыта от глаз пользователя и можно ли её удалить или переместить — именно эти аспекты мы рассмотрим детально.
Эта системная директория является критически важной для работы современного интерфейса Microsoft Store и встроенных приложений. Удаление или некорректное изменение прав доступа к ней может привести к неработоспособности калькулятора, магазина, фотогалереи и других стандартных компонентов системы. Поэтому прежде чем совершать какие-либо действия, необходимо четко понимать архитектуру хранения данных в современных версиях Windows.
В данной статье мы разберем техническое назначение папки, объясним, как получить к ней доступ без потери гарантии системы, и рассмотрим безопасные способы управления её содержимым. Вы узнаете, почему стандартные методы удаления файлов здесь не работают и какие инструменты лучше использовать для оптимизации дискового пространства.
Назначение и структура директории WindowsApps
Директория WindowsApps была внедрена Microsoft начиная с версии Windows 8, но наибольшее распространение и важность приобрела в "десятке" и одиннадцатой версии ОС. Её главная задача — служить хранилищем для всех приложений, установленных через официальный магазин Microsoft Store. Сюда же попадают компоненты универсальных приложений Windows (UWP), которые являются основой современной экосистемы Microsoft.
В отличие от классических программ, устанавливаемых в C:\Program Files, приложения в этой папке работают в изолированной среде. Это обеспечивает повышенную безопасность и стабильность работы системы, так как приложения не имеют прямого доступа к критическим системным файлам без специального разрешения. Структура папки строго иерархична и организована по уникальным идентификаторам пакетов.
Каждое приложение здесь имеет свой подкаталог, имя которого формируется по сложному шабону, включающему название разработчика, имя приложения и его версию. Например, путь может выглядеть как Microsoft.WindowsCalculator_10.2103.8.0_x64__8wekyb3d8bbwe. Такая детализация позволяет системе хранить несколько версий одного приложения одновременно или управлять зависимостями между разными программами.
- 📦 Хранение исполняемых файлов UWP-приложений и их библиотек.
- 🔐 Изоляция данных для предотвращения конфликтов и повышения безопасности.
- 🔄 Автомическое управление обновлениями через фоновые службы системы.
- 🛡️ Контроль целостности файлов с помощью цифровых подписей Microsoft.
- Да, значительно
- Нет, размер стабильный
- Я удалил всё вручную
- Не знаю, где она находится
Важно отметить, что внутри этой папки также хранятся данные для работы Cortana, голосового ввода и некоторых системных виджетов. Попытка вручную редактировать файлы внутри этих директорий часто приводит к ошибкам запуска соответствующих сервисов. Система строго следит за целостностью содержимого, и любое вмешательство может быть расценено как нарушение безопасности.
Почему папка скрыта и защищена доступом
При попытке открыть папку WindowsApps пользователь чаще всего сталкивается с сообщением об отказе в доступе. Это не баг, а продуманная функция безопасности. По умолчанию доступ к этой директории имеет только системная учетная запись TrustedInstaller и группа ALL APPLICATION PACKAGES. Обычный пользователь, даже обладающий правами администратора, формально не имеет прав на чтение или запись в эту папку.
Такая защита необходима для предотвращения случайного или злонамеренного повреждения системных файлов. Если бы доступ был открыт, вирусы или неопытные пользователи могли бы легко удалить критически важные компоненты, что привело бы к необходимости переустанавливать операционную систему. Скрытый атрибут папки также помогает избегать случайных действий.
⚠️ Внимание: Принудительное изменение владельца папки без необходимости может нарушить работу обновлений Windows. После смены владельца система может перестать автоматически обновлять приложения из Microsoft Store.
Для получения доступа необходимо вручную изменить владельца папки в свойствах безопасности. Этот процесс требует осторожности. Сначала нужно отключить отображение скрытых элементов, затем перейти в свойства папки, вкладку Безопасность и нажать кнопку Дополнительно. Только там можно сменить владельца на текущего пользователя.
Риски смены владельца папки
Смена владельца открывает доступ ко всем вложенным файлам, что теоретически позволяет вредоносному ПО легко модифицировать системные приложения. После завершения работ рекомендуется вернуть владельца в исходное состояние (TrustedInstaller), хотя это не всегда возможно сделать штатными средствами без сброса прав доступа.
Стоит помнить, что даже после получения прав доступа, некоторые файлы могут оставаться заблокированными, если они используются системой в данный момент. В таких случаях попытки их удаления или перемещения будут безуспешны до перезагрузки или остановки соответствующих служб. Это дополнительный уровень защиты целостности операционной системы.
Можно ли удалять файлы из WindowsApps
Короткий ответ — нет, удалять файлы вручную через Проводник нельзя. Прямое удаление папок или файлов из директории WindowsApps приведет к ошибкам в работе приложений и может потребовать сброса системы. Удаление должно производиться исключительно штатными средствами Windows, которые корректно обновляют реестр и удаляют связанные записи.
Если вы попытаетесь просто нажать Delete на папку с приложением, вы, скорее всего, получите ошибку доступа или, в лучшем случае, удалите файлы, но оставите "мусор" в реестре. Это приведет к тому, что система будет считать приложение установленным, но запустить его будет невозможно. Корректное удаление возможно только через меню параметров.
- ❌ Не используйте Shift+Delete для файлов в этой папке.
- ❌ Не применяйте сторонние программы-шредеры для этой директории.
- ✅ Используйте встроенный инструмент "Приложения и возможности".
- ✅ Используйте PowerShell для принудительного удаления остатков.
Существуют ситуации, когда приложение повреждено и не удаляется стандартным способом. В этом случае лучше воспользоваться командной строкой или PowerShell. Например, команда
Get-AppxPackage -Name *имя_приложения* | Remove-AppxPackage позволяет удалить пакет программно, соблюдая все системные протоколы безопасности.
☑️ Безопасное удаление приложения
Как переместить папку WindowsApps на другой диск
Одной из самых частых проблем пользователей является переполнение системного диска C. Возникает логичный вопрос: можно ли переместить папку WindowsApps на другой диск? Технически это возможно, но Microsoft не рекомендует делать это путем простого перетаскивания или изменения реестра, так как это может привести к нестабильной работе.
Официальный и безопасный способ — изменение места установки новых приложений в параметрах Windows. Для этого нужно перейти в Параметры → Система → Память и выбрать опцию изменения места сохранения новых содержимого. Здесь можно указать диск D или E для установки новых приложений, что автоматически создаст новую папку WindowsApps на выбранном диске.
Перемещение уже установленных приложений возможно, но не для всех. В меню Приложения и возможности выберите нужное приложение, нажмите Переместить и укажите новый диск. Если кнопка неактивна, значит, данное конкретное приложение или системный компонент не поддерживает перемещение.
⚠️ Внимание: Перемещение системных приложений (календарь, почта, магазин) на другой диск может замедлить их запуск, особенно если второй диск является HDD, а не SSD. Критические компоненты системы лучше оставить на быстром системном разделе.
Существуют методы создания символических ссылок (symlink) для переноса папки, но они требуют глубоких знаний и не гарантируют стабильность работы после крупных обновлений Windows. При обновлении системы пути могут быть сброшены, что приведет к ошибкам. Поэтому использование встроенных функций настроек является единственно верным решением для большинства пользователей.
Анализ занимаемого места и очистка
Для анализа того, что именно занимает место в папке WindowsApps, не обязательно открывать саму папку. Встроенные средства Windows предоставляют достаточно информации. В разделе Параметры → Система → Приложения и возможности можно отсортировать список по размеру и увидеть, какие программы потребляют больше всего ресурсов.
Часто пользователи обнаруживают, что много места занимают игры, купленные в Microsoft Store, или кэш карт. Также значительный объем могут занимать старые версии приложений, которые система хранит на случай необходимости отката. Очистка временных файлов также помогает освободить место, связанное с работой магазина.
Для более глубокой очистки можно использовать встроенную утилиту Очистка диска. Запустите её, выберите системный диск и нажмите кнопку Очистить системные файлы. В списке найдите пункт, связанный с временными файлами установки или кэшем Windows Store, и удалите их.
| Тип содержимого | Расположение | Метод очистки | Риск удаления |
|---|---|---|---|
| Игры и программы | WindowsApps | Удаление через Параметры | Низкий (штатный метод) |
| Кэш магазина | Temp / Cache | Команда wsreset.exe | Низкий |
| Временные файлы | System Temp | Очистка диска | Низкий |
| Системные компоненты | WindowsApps | Не рекомендуется | Высокий (сбой системы) |
Используйте команду wsreset.exe в окне Выполнить (Win+R), чтобы очистить кэш Microsoft Store. Это безопасно и часто решает проблемы с загрузкой приложений, освобождая немного места.
Типичные ошибки и способы их решения
Работа с приложениями из WindowsApps не всегда проходит гладко. Пользователи часто сталкиваются с ошибками запуска, зависаниями при обновлении или сообщениями о нехватке места, даже когда оно есть. Одна из распространенных проблем — ошибка 0x80073CF0, указывающая на повреждение пакета.
Для решения таких проблем существует мощный инструмент — сброс приложений. В меню Приложения и возможности выберите проблемное приложение, нажмите Дополнительные параметры и найдите кнопку Сброс. Это вернет приложение к заводскому состоянию, удалив его настройки и кэш, но сохранив установку.
Если проблема носит системный характер и касается самого магазина или множества приложений, поможет переустановка компонентов PowerShell. Запустите консоль от имени администратора и выполните команду для регистрации всех встроенных приложений. Это восстановит缺失ющие связи в реестре.
- 🔧 Сброс кэша магазина через
wsreset. - 🔧 Проверка целостности системных файлов командой
sfc /scannow. - 🔧 Переоценка приложений через PowerShell скрипты.
- 🔧 Отключение антивируса на время установки крупных обновлений.
⚠️ Внимание: При выполнении скриптов PowerShell внимательно проверяйте синтаксис команд. Ошибка в коде может привести к удалению всех встроенных приложений, включая панель управления и поиск, восстановление которых потребует сложных манипуляций.
В некоторых случаях помогает простой перезапуск службы Windows Update. Зайдите в службы (services.msc), найдите Центр обновления Windows, остановите её, очистите папку SoftwareDistribution и запустите службу снова. Это часто решает проблемы с зависшими обновлениями приложений.
Большинство проблем с папкой WindowsApps решаются стандартными средствами диагностики Windows. Ручное вмешательство в файловую структуру папки требуется крайне редко и несет высокие риски.
FAQ: Часто задаваемые вопросы
Почему папка WindowsApps имеет странные имена папок внутри?
Имена папок формируются автоматически системой и содержат название пакета, версию, архитектуру процессора и уникальный хэш разработчика. Это позволяет системе различать разные версии одного приложения и управлять зависимостями без конфликтов имен файлов.
Можно ли полностью отключить создание этой папки?
Нет, в современных версиях Windows 10 и 11 это невозможно без полной потери функциональности магазина приложений и встроенных компонентов системы. Даже если вы не пользуетесь магазином, системные процессы используют эту структуру для работы интерфейса.
Безопасно ли менять права доступа навсегда?
Постоянное изменение прав доступа снижает общий уровень безопасности системы. После завершения необходимых операций (например, резервного копирования или ручной чистки логов) рекомендуется вернуть владельца TrustedInstaller, если это позволяет сделать текущее состояние системы.
Что делать, если антивирус ругается на файлы в этой папке?
Файлы в WindowsApps имеют цифровую подпись Microsoft. Если антивирус реагирует на них, это может быть ложным срабатыванием. Однако, если подозрение вызывает конкретный исполняемый файл, стоит проверить его через онлайн-сервисы вроде VirusTotal, предварительно скопировав файл в другую папку.